Released in 1979, 草迷宮 is a fantasía, drama and romance film directed by Shūji Terayama, running about 41 minutes.
What it’s about. Akira is haunted by a "bouncing ball" song that he remembers his mother singing when he was a small child, and now on the verge of a sexually active adulthood, he wants to find the origins of the song. The young man ostensibly wanders into a time-warp in which aspects from his childhood and adulthood mix together. In this never-never land he comes across a beautiful woman/witch who is lost inside the labyrinth of her mansion, just as the young man is lost in the labyrinth of time — and on some levels, perhaps the labyrinth of his subconscious.
Who’s in it. 草迷宮 stars Hiroshi Mikami as Young Akira, Takeshi Wakamatsu as Akira as a man, Keiko Niitaka as Mother and Jūzō Itami as Principal / Priest / Old man, among others.
